Animal Health Week Proclaimed in Saskatchewan

This week is Animal Health Week in Saskatchewan.

This year’s national theme is, “Animal Welfare: Safeguarding the Five Animal Freedoms.”

“Saskatchewan’s livestock producers are dedicated to ensuring the health and welfare of their animals. They take great pride in using animal care practices that keep their livestock healthy and stress-free,” says Agriculture Minister Lyle Stewart.

The Five Animal Freedoms are proper nutrition, proper socialization, adequate shelter, appropriate veterinary care and ability to exhibit normal behaviour.

Saskatchewan’s Animal Health Week coincides with Animal Health Week in Canada, as proclaimed by the Canadian Veterinary Medical Association.
